Select Sport Drilled and Slotted Vented 1-Piece Front Driver Side Brake Rotor (227.42076L) by StopTech®. This C-Tek™ rotor is custom crafted for your specific year, make, and model vehicle to provide performance-stopping power while meeting all OEM fit and quality specifications. Drilled and slotted, the disc will quickly expunge hot gases and debris for predictable and smooth braking experience.
Specifications:
- Driving Style: Daily Driver, Hauling & Towing, Performance / Racing
- Rotor Construction: 1-Piece
- Rotor Style: Drilled & Slotted
- Rotor Type: Vented
- Rotor Diameter: 324mm (12.76")
- Rotor Height: 49.1mm (1.93")
- Nominal Thickness: 30mm (1.18")
- Minimum Thickness: 28.4mm (1.118")
- Lug Holes Quantity: 5
- Lug Holes Size: 12.7mm (0.5")
- Bolt Circle: 114.3mm (4.5")
- Hub Hole Diameter: 68mm (2.677")
- Quantity: 1 Per Pack

Benefits:
- Slots help to increase pad bite and improve air circulation
- Drilled Holes and Slots create an escape route for debris, dust, gases, and water
- Slots clean and de-glaze pad surface for optimum pad coefficient of friction
- Drilled rotors improve the appearance of your wheels and provide reduced rotor weight
- Vented type of rotors offer much faster heat dissipation

StopTech® has been awarded the highly coveted TÜV approval on several big brake kits. StopTech kits successfully passed TÜV’s demanding series of tests that range from performance and durability, to proper fitment and ease of installation. Although TÜV certification is not required in all countries, TÜV approval demonstrates that StopTech’s Balanced Brake Upgrades meet the rigorous standards set by this respected German Agency. StopTech Big Brake Kits have been awarded a Teilgutachten. The complete kit is certified to run on a particular application, so customers do not need to pay for further testing with the TÜV agency.

Polyurethane Care, Installation & Painting (Poly) |
All polyurethane parts will come raw and unpainted. These parts are flexible so they may slightly warp during shipment. Slightly warped polyurethane parts are not considered defective. They will require a few hours of sunlight to return to its original shape from when it came out of the mold. Polyurethane parts are much different than factory OEM parts and require specific preparation before painting. Improper paint preparation will result in the paint not adhering to the bumper, pin holes and bubbles. It is normal for polyurethane parts to come slightly scratched with imperfections. Proper sanding during paint preparation will remove all imperfections. Please seek a professional and reputable body shop with experience with polyurethane aftermarket parts.
